Putting AI to Work in Disciplinary Literacy Robin Gregg It highlights perspectives of contextualCan generative AI support not supplant students' reading, writing, critical thinking, and problem solving skills? In this practical, literacy centered guide, Rachel Karchmer Klein shows how AI tools like ChatGPT and Copilot can be integrated into grades 6 12 instruction without compromising academic rigor or student voice.
